| contents | In this paper, we investigate the underlying geometry of the Spence--Kummer functional equation for the trilogarithm. Our geometry determines a certain path system on the projective line minus three points, connecting the standard tangential base point to the nine variables of the $Li_{3}$ terms in the equation, which reflects the geometry of the so-called non-Fano arrangement. Consequently, we derive a precise form of the Spence--Kummer equation together with its $\ell$-adic Galois analogue by using algebraic relations between polylogarithm generating series arising from the path system. We apply the tensor and homotopy criteria for functional equations of iterated integrals due to Zagier and Nakamura--Wojtkowiak. To compute the lower-degree terms of the functional equation in both the complex and the $\ell$-adic Galois cases, we also focus on a diagram of three geometric objects: the moduli space $M_{0,5}$, the complement to the Coxeter arrangement of type ${\rm B_3}$, and the complement to the non-Fano arrangement. |
